About Oxford Medical Simulation
OMS helps health systems, nursing schools, and medical schools deliver training and assessment better, cheaper, faster and at scale.
Our award-winning simulation platform is transforming the way healthcare and educational institutions train, assess, and recruit healthcare professionals. By combining cutting-edge 3D visualization with artificial intelligence and leading educational theory, OMS delivers all of the benefits of physical simulation while driving significant savings and improving patient care.
Founded in 2017 and commercially launching the award-winning OMS Platform in late 2018, OMS has experienced rapid growth with deployments spanning more than 100 Healthcare and Academic institutions around the world including Mayo Clinic, Advent Health, Johns Hopkins, the NHS, and the world’s #1 pediatric hospital.
